亚洲最大看欧美片,亚洲图揄拍自拍另类图片,欧美精品v国产精品v呦,日本在线精品视频免费

  • 站長資訊網(wǎng)
    最全最豐富的資訊網(wǎng)站

    php中怎么將json數(shù)據(jù)轉(zhuǎn)為數(shù)組

    在php中,可以json_decode()函數(shù)來將JSON字符串?dāng)?shù)據(jù)轉(zhuǎn)換為數(shù)組。默認(rèn)情況下,json_decode()函數(shù)將返回一個對象,但當(dāng)?shù)诙€參數(shù)設(shè)置為布爾值true時,則可將JSON數(shù)據(jù)解碼為關(guān)聯(lián)數(shù)組。

    php中怎么將json數(shù)據(jù)轉(zhuǎn)為數(shù)組

    本教程操作環(huán)境:windows7系統(tǒng)、PHP7.1版,DELL G3電腦

    在PHP中可以使用json_decode()函數(shù)將JSON編碼的字符串轉(zhuǎn)換為適當(dāng)?shù)腜HP數(shù)據(jù)類型。默認(rèn)情況下,json_decode()函數(shù)將返回一個對象;但是,可以指定第二個參數(shù)為一個布爾值true,這樣JSON值將被解碼為關(guān)聯(lián)數(shù)組。

    基本語法:

    json_decode( $json, $assoc = FALSE, $depth = 512, $options = 0 )

    參數(shù):json_decode()函數(shù)接受如上所述的四個參數(shù),如下所述:

    ● json:它包含需要解碼的JSON字符串。它僅適用于UTF-8編碼的字符串。

    ● assoc:它是一個布爾變量。如果為true,則返回的對象將轉(zhuǎn)換為關(guān)聯(lián)數(shù)組。

    ● depth:它表示用戶指定的遞歸深度。

    ● options:它包括JSON_OBJECT_AS_ARRAY的位掩碼,JSON_BIGINT_AS_STRING,JSON_THROW_ON_ERROR。

    返回值:此函數(shù)以適當(dāng)?shù)腜HP類型返回已編碼的JSON值。如果json無法解碼或者編碼數(shù)據(jù)比遞歸限制更深,則返回NULL。

    示例:把json轉(zhuǎn)換成關(guān)聯(lián)數(shù)組

    <?php  // 在PHP變量中存儲JSON數(shù)據(jù)  $json = '{"Peter":65,"Harry":80,"John":78,"Clark":90}';  var_dump(json_decode($json, true));  ?>

    上面示例的輸出將如下所示:

    php中怎么將json數(shù)據(jù)轉(zhuǎn)為數(shù)組

    推薦學(xué)習(xí):《PHP視頻教程》

    贊(0)
    分享到: 更多 (0)
    網(wǎng)站地圖   滬ICP備18035694號-2    滬公網(wǎng)安備31011702889846號